Copper(II) hydroxide phosphate, with the chemical formula Cu2(OH)PO4, is a blue-green, crystalline compound that is formed by the reaction of copper(II) ions with phosphate and hydroxide ions. It is a type of copper phosphate and is often used as a fungicide, particularly in the treatment of plant diseases caused by fungal infections. The compound is also known for its role in the natural weathering of copper minerals and can be found in certain copper ores. Due to its copper content, it is important to handle Copper(II) hydroxide phosphate with care, as copper can be toxic to both humans and animals if ingested in large quantities.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 1318-84-9 includes 7 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 4 digits, 1,3,1 and 8 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 8 and 4 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 1318-84:
(6*1)+(5*3)+(4*1)+(3*8)+(2*8)+(1*4)=69
69 % 10 = 9
So 1318-84-9 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
